NAME
    gcloud alpha pubsub lite-subscriptions create - create a Pub/Sub Lite
        subscription

SYNOPSIS
    gcloud alpha pubsub lite-subscriptions create SUBSCRIPTION --topic=TOPIC
        [--delivery-requirement=DELIVERY_REQUIREMENT;
          default="deliver-immediately"] [--location=LOCATION]
        [--starting-offset=STARTING_OFFSET; default="end"]
        [GCLOUD_WIDE_FLAG ...]

DESCRIPTION
    (ALPHA) Create a Pub/Sub Lite subscription.

EXAMPLES
    To create a Pub/Sub Lite subscription, run:

        $ gcloud alpha pubsub lite-subscriptions create mysubscription \
          --location=us-central1-a --topic=mytopic

    To create a Pub/Sub Lite subscription at the offset of the oldest retained
    message, run:

        $ gcloud alpha pubsub lite-subscriptions create mysubscription \
          --location=us-central1-a --topic=mytopic \
          --starting-offset=beginning

POSITIONAL ARGUMENTS
     SUBSCRIPTION
        Subscription ID.

REQUIRED FLAGS
     --topic=TOPIC
        Topic ID associated with the subscription.

OPTIONAL FLAGS
     --delivery-requirement=DELIVERY_REQUIREMENT; default="deliver-immediately"
        When this subscription should send messages to subscribers relative to
        messages persistence in storage. See
        https://cloud.google.com/pubsub/lite/docs/subscriptions#creating_lite_subscriptions
        for more info. DELIVERY_REQUIREMENT must be one of:
        deliver-after-stored, deliver-immediately.

     Location resource - Identifies the Cloud zone this command will be
     executed on. This represents a Cloud resource. (NOTE) Some attributes are
     not given arguments in this group but can be set in other ways. To set the
     project attribute:
      ◆ provide the argument --location on the command line with a fully
        specified name;
      ◆ provide the argument --zone on the command line with a fully
        specified name;
      ◆ provide the argument --project on the command line;
      ◆ set the property core/project.

       --location=LOCATION
          ID of the location or fully qualified identifier for the location. To
          set the location attribute:
          ▸ provide the argument --location on the command line;
          ▸ provide the argument --zone on the command line.

     --starting-offset=STARTING_OFFSET; default="end"
        The offset at which a newly created or seeked subscription will start
        receiving messages. A subscription can be initialized at the offset of
        the oldest retained message (beginning), or at the current HEAD offset
        (end). STARTING_OFFSET must be one of: beginning, end.
